Extension Expert in Newspaper Story on Caterpillar

A Bangor Daily News story about a rise in abundance of the Hickory Tussock caterpillar included comments from UMaine Cooperative Extension entomologist Clay Kirby. Kirby told the BDN he has more samples of the caterpillar sent to his laboratory and more information requests than previous years. The numbers of the caterpillar, which can cause an allergic reaction in some people, may be rising due to weather influences, parasites, predators, diseases, or human effects, Kirby added.
